Verisk Analytics (NASDAQ:VRSK -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, July 29th. The business services provider reported $1.98 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$1.93 by $0.05. Verisk Analytics had a negative return on equity of 239.55% and a net margin of 28.24%.The business had revenue of $806.30 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$804.02 million.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$1.88 earnings per share. Verisk Analytics's revenue was up 4.3% on a year-over-year basis. Verisk Analytics has set its FY 2026 guidance at 7.450-7.750 E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that Verisk Analytics, Inc. will post 7.71 earnings per share for the current year.

Verisk Analytics Profile

(Free Report)

Verisk Analytics, Inc NASDAQ: VRSK is a data analytics and decision‑support provider that helps organizations assess and manage risk. The company supplies data, predictive models and software to customers in insurance, reinsurance, financial services, government, energy and other commercial markets. Its offerings are designed to support underwriting, pricing, claims management, catastrophe modeling, fraud detection and regulatory compliance, enabling clients to make more informed operational and strategic decisions.

Verisk's product portfolio combines large proprietary datasets with analytics platforms and industry‑specific applications.
